A new look for Bankers Briefcases

Bankers at Sibos are going to have to update their briefcases after Artists For Humanity (AFH) showcases The Banker’s Briefcases collection for Art@Sibos.

In a new initiative to bring art to the Sibos exhibition floor, Art@Sibos will present delegates with a creative interpretation of industry issues.

Sibos has partnered with AFH, Boston’s nationally acclaimed teen art and design enterprise, to create the Sibos Gallery.

Topical themes of the nine-piece installation include cyber-security, technological evolution and occupy Wall Street.

The Sibos Gallery will be officially opened in a ribbon cutting ceremony at 10am on the Monday in the Art@Sibos space, with Jason Talbot, AFH co-counder and special projects director, Sven Bossu, head of Sibos and Blanche Petre, legal counsel, SWIFT.
